Description
This detached bungalow, known as Byfields, is a rare opportunity to acquire a property with significant potential for extension and refurbishment. Situated in the rural hamlet of Coolham, the property currently has planning permission to extend into a two-storey family home, not seen for sale since the 1960s. The property boasts a generous plot of 0.3 acres, with uninterrupted views over open farmland to the west. The current accommodation offers three double bedrooms, a bathroom, kitchen breakfast room, dining area, and a large lounge with fireplace and parquet floor. The property also features a double garage/workshop and a utility/boot room. With its west-facing wraparound garden, there is huge potential to extend the ground floor, subject to planning permission. Alternatively, a cosmetic refurbishment of the existing property is also a viable option. The property is approached via a tarmac driveway, providing parking for 3/4 cars, and has a unique charm and character that makes it an attractive opportunity for anyone looking to put their own stamp on a property.
